    What does the ABS warning light look like on a Renault?

    orange ABS warning light Renault

    On Renault vehicles, the ABS warning light is easy to recognise. It is a circle surrounded by two parentheses, with the letters "ABS" in the centre.

    This symbol lights up in orange on the dashboard, usually when the ignition is turned on. It should normally turn off after a few seconds.

    If it remains lit while driving, it means a fault has been detected in the anti-lock braking system. This warning light may appear alone or alongside other indicators depending on the source of the problem.

    Why might the ABS warning light come on?

    On Renault models such as the Clio, Mégane, Captur, or Scénic, the ABS warning light may illuminate. This can be caused by various components of the braking system or onboard electronics:

    • Faulty wheel sensors: if they transmit incorrect information, the ABS warning light may illuminate intermittently.
    • Defective ABS module: in case of failure, the warning light remains on and cannot be cleared without repair.
    • Insufficient or contaminated brake fluid: low pressure, leaks, or impurities can trigger the warning light.
    • Low battery: insufficient voltage can disrupt the ABS system's operation.

    The ABS warning light no longer appears on your dashboard.

    If the fault is not truly resolved, clearing the warning light will not suffice: it will reappear as soon as the system detects the issue again.
